I am writing this today to report an "offer scam" called extenZe. I was reading up on it because I signed up for it on Git-R-Free and wanted to make sure I cancelled it, even though I never got the product and my bank account hadn't been charged for it...yet.
I google searched "extenZe canellation" and found out that its a fruad company. They'll charge the account for the .97 cents or whatever for the trail period but then either you can't call them or they never answer emails or they'll keep charging you for more product they just keep sending, even though you've cancelled the account.

If you signed up with a debit card, you can prevent future charges by canceling the card. The replacement will have a different card number. It's a pain in the ass, but it will keep you from paying for stuff you don't want and/or aren't even getting. |
